blob: 80099f9983e7233fad4e05093125b5fd95d89df6 [file] [log] [blame]
/*
* Handle resume from suspend-to-disk
*/
#include <stdio.h>
#include <stdlib.h>
#include "resume.h"
char *progname;
static __noreturn usage(void)
{
fprintf(stderr, "Usage: %s /dev/<resumedevice> [offset]\n", progname);
exit(1);
}
int main(int argc, char *argv[], char *envp[])
{
progname = argv[0];
if (argc < 2 || argc > 3)
usage();
return resume(argv[1], (argc > 2) ? strtoull(argv[2], NULL, 0) : 0ULL);
}